Skills for maximizing potential yield;

Mining V
Astrogeology V
Mining Barge V (You'll need this if you plan to hit Exhumers, but IV is enough)
Exhumers V (Assuming you do Exhumers, and the bonus is eh, so IV is OK)
Cybernetics V (For those high end implants, usually IV is enough, optional)
Mining Upgrades IV (For T2 Upgrades), V is you want to free up CPU for some shield tank modules
Mining Drones V (If you even use them, but they do make a difference, but in your case, you'll want drones to shoo the high-sec rats off)

As for your fitting....

Retriever (Yield will depend on what you mine, and what crystals you use)
[High Slots]
Modulated Strip Miner II [With Appropriate T2 Crystals]
Modulated Strip Miner II [With Appropriate T2 Crystals]

[Mid Slots]
Any Shield modules (Assuming your upgrades don't eat your CPU)

[Low Slots] (Yes, Laser Upgrades do stack!)
Mining Laser Upgrade II
Mining Laser Upgrade II
Mining Laser Upgrade II

In order to not POP a rock, you can use a survey scanner (Very cheap). As stated above, subtract what's in the rock with your yield, and cut your cycle whenever you're almost about to pop it.

There's my two cents.

If you want to go even FURTHER, you'll want an Orca booster. Of course, that requires a second character entirely. I'll let you decide if you want that or not. (They can provide a solid 20% bonus to yield).

i would be putting a scanner in the mid so you don't waist time on nearly empty roids, while poping roids with normal mining lasers is not a big waist the 3min timer and large volume being pulled by strips adds up very quickly.

I'll add in that trying to tank a Retriever is pretty pointless, because as others have pointed out it only has one mid-slot. The Retriever's best defense against ganking is simply that it's really not worth it. They're cheap & easily replaced, so a ganker force will probably end up spending more replacing their own ships than yours should they go that route. So anyone who ganks Retrievers is doing it for kicks, not profit or even "hostile market takeover." It's just not worth it from an ISK standpoint.

So that being said, just go for maximum yield and get your money back faster.

A Mackinaw is a whole different story, of course. That you will want to tank, because it's expensive enough to catch the attention of gankers of all types and not just the truly idiotic ones.
